Medtech AI is an AI-powered clinical documentation and patient communication platform built specifically for New Zealand healthcare. Deeply integrated with Medtech Evolution, it functions as an ambient AI medical scribe that captures consultations in real time and converts them into structured clinical notes.
During the consultation, Medtech AI generates a live medical transcript, structured notes in formats such as SOAP, referral letters, and clear consultation summaries. It also surfaces key patient information including previous consultation notes, medications, conditions, allergies, immunisations, screenings, and outstanding tasks within a central dashboard.
Every AI-generated output is reviewed and approved by the clinician before being written back into the Practice Management Software. Medtech AI assists clinical workflows but does not replace clinical judgment.
With no audio retention, Medtech AI is designed for regulated healthcare environments. It helps clinicians reduce documentation time, improve note quality, enhance patient understanding through health literacy-adjusted email summaries, and maintain full control over every consultation.
Medtech AI integrates natively with Medtech Evolution using Medtech ALEX®.
When launched alongside Medtech Evolution, relevant patient context such as previous consultation notes, medications, conditions, allergies, immunisations, and screenings is automatically passed through. Notes and correspondence can be written directly back into the Daily Record and Patient Outbox.
There is no copying and pasting, no disconnected systems, and no third-party workflow gaps. All data remains within the Medtech ecosystem, which differentiates Medtech AI from unintegrated AI scribe tools.

The platform aligns with the New Zealand Health Information Privacy Code. All data is processed and stored locally within New Zealand to support data residency and compliance requirements.
No. Medtech AI does not store consultation audio. Audio is processed in real time and immediately discarded.
Because audio is not retained, any internet disruption before approval will result in the recording being lost.
The system does not store patient names, dates of birth, or NHI numbers.
Medtech AI uses medical-grade AI transcription optimised for clinical terminology. It performs reliably in real-world environments, including multi-speaker consultations.
Clinician review is mandatory before any documentation is saved or clinical records updated, ensuring accuracy, safety, and medico-legal confidence.
For best results, allow the system to continue recording for a few seconds after speaking to avoid cutting off the final words of the consultation.
Yes. Medtech AI supports structured clinical notes in SOAP, APSO, Emergency, Mental Health, and specialty-specific templates. A clinician can also create custom templates to suit their clinical note style.
It can generate referral letters, clinical correspondence, diagnosis codes, screenings, and structured summaries. Custom prompts and specialty workflows can also be configured to suit different clinical settings.

Medtech AI is available via secure web access alongside Medtech Evolution. Mobile applications are available through the Apple App Store and Google Play Store.
The appointment booking feature allows clinicians to view appointments up to two hours ahead and two hours behind the current time.
This feature is particularly useful in emergency and urgent care settings where patient flow and rapid access to consultations are essential.

No. Medtech AI is designed with a lightweight, cloud based architecture that has minimal impact on clinic computers, servers, or network infrastructure.
Some competitor AI medical scribing tools rely heavily on local device processing and caching. In larger medical centres, this can create significant resource intensity for clinic networks and IT systems. For example, a centre with 15 clinicians running simultaneously could require more than 300 Mbps of sustained network bandwidth just for the competitor scribe software, in addition to the other systems already running in the practice.
Medtech AI is architected very differently. Both the web version and mobile application are lightweight because all processing occurs in secure cloud infrastructure rather than on the local machine. This includes transcription, AI processing, and clinical note generation.
